Coffee Extract Market Overview
Coffee extract is derived from coffee beans, utilizing advanced extraction methods to preserve the natural flavors, antioxidants, and bioactive compounds present in coffee. These extracts are used primarily in the food and beverage industry for flavoring and health benefits. Additionally, coffee extract’s increasing application in personal care and cosmetic products further supports its growth.
The market is driven by several factors, including a growing preference for natural ingredients, the clean-label movement, and the rise of health-conscious consumers seeking functional products. Coffee extract contains valuable compounds such as caffeine, polyphenols, and antioxidants, making it a versatile ingredient in the development of energy drinks, protein bars, functional beverages, and skincare products.
Furthermore, the increasing popularity of coffee consumption worldwide has helped the market for coffee extract expand. As more consumers embrace coffee as a daily beverage and seek additional ways to incorporate its benefits into their diets and personal care routines, coffee extract is positioned as an ideal ingredient for various applications.

3. Sustainability and Ethical Sourcing
Sustainability has become an essential factor for consumers when making purchasing decisions. The coffee industry is especially affected by sustainability concerns, as coffee production is resource-intensive and vulnerable to climate change. Coffee extract producers are increasingly adopting sustainable sourcing practices, such as fair-trade certifications and organic farming, to meet consumer demand for ethically produced products.
Supercritical CO2 extraction, an environmentally friendly method, is becoming more common in the coffee extract industry. This extraction process not only preserves the quality of coffee but also reduces the environmental footprint compared to traditional methods. As consumers demand greater transparency and eco-conscious practices, coffee extract companies that focus on sustainability are likely to gain a competitive edge.

2. Personal Care and Cosmetics Applications
Another growing trend is the use of coffee extract in personal care and cosmetics. Coffee extract is known for its antioxidant properties, making it an ideal ingredient in skincare products, including anti-aging creams, facial scrubs, and lotions. It is also used in hair care products for its potential to stimulate circulation and promote hair growth.
The increasing demand for natural, plant-based ingredients in personal care products is driving coffee extract’s adoption in the beauty industry. With consumers becoming more mindful of the ingredients in their skincare products, coffee extract’s natural properties position it as a key player in the growing clean beauty movement.
